Improve VersionedMigration naming conventions (#2264)

As suggested by @ggwpez
(https://github.com/paritytech/polkadot-sdk/pull/2142#discussion_r1388145872),
remove the `VersionChecked` prefix from version checked migrations (but
leave `VersionUnchecked` prefixes)

---------

Co-authored-by: command-bot <>
This commit is contained in:
Liam Aharon
2023-11-10 17:14:05 +04:00
committed by GitHub
parent 3f0383a5b8
commit 84ddbaf684
7 changed files with 28 additions and 30 deletions
+7 -8
View File
@@ -95,14 +95,13 @@ impl<
/// [`VersionUncheckedMigrateToV2`] wrapped in a [`frame_support::migrations::VersionedMigration`],
/// ensuring the migration is only performed when on-chain version is 0.
pub type VersionCheckedMigrateToV2<T, I, PastPayouts> =
frame_support::migrations::VersionedMigration<
0,
2,
VersionUncheckedMigrateToV2<T, I, PastPayouts>,
crate::pallet::Pallet<T, I>,
<T as frame_system::Config>::DbWeight,
>;
pub type MigrateToV2<T, I, PastPayouts> = frame_support::migrations::VersionedMigration<
0,
2,
VersionUncheckedMigrateToV2<T, I, PastPayouts>,
crate::pallet::Pallet<T, I>,
<T as frame_system::Config>::DbWeight,
>;
pub(crate) mod old {
use super::*;
+2 -2
View File
@@ -51,7 +51,7 @@ use sp_std::marker::PhantomData;
/// // OnRuntimeUpgrade implementation...
/// }
///
/// pub type VersionCheckedMigrateV5ToV6<T, I> =
/// pub type MigrateV5ToV6<T, I> =
/// VersionedMigration<
/// 5,
/// 6,
@@ -63,7 +63,7 @@ use sp_std::marker::PhantomData;
/// // Migrations tuple to pass to the Executive pallet:
/// pub type Migrations = (
/// // other migrations...
/// VersionCheckedMigrateV5ToV6<T, ()>,
/// MigrateV5ToV6<T, ()>,
/// // other migrations...
/// );
/// ```